N2 - This study aims to establish the relationship between virtual platforms and cooperative work.Its approach is quantitative, descriptive, correlational, and cross-sectional.The population consisted of 135 students from the Electronics and Informatics programs of a public university in Lima, distributed across 6 cohorts, corresponding to the academic periods from 2019 to 2023.The results indicate that the dimension of virtual platforms in the use of digital tools correlates with cooperative work.At higher levels of the virtual platforms dimension, cooperative work is greater, even after the Spearman correlation coefficient of 0.539, representing a moderately positive correlation.Similarly, if we increase r2, we obtain a variance of the common factor r2 = 0.290, indicating a common variance of 29.0%.As a result, it is confirmed that there is a significant relationship between the use of virtual platforms and the cooperative work of students in the Electronics and Informatics program..
